**Mgmt Meeting Minutes — Retiring the Brightline Range**

Quick recap for sales leads at Fenholt Supplies: we agreed to retire the Brightline fixture range by year-end. Remaining stock moves to clearance pricing next month, and accounts on standing orders get migrated to the Lumetta range. Trade-in incentives were approved in principle. The confidential note on next steps sits just below.

board note of bajof-bajeg: The pricing group signed off on a budget of $13.4 million for Project Sildor. The renewal with Lamixek Holdings closes at $48.9 million a year, 49 percent above the last contract.

Key Ceremony Checklist — Sweeper Unseal (Morrow Retention)

[ ] Confirm the data-retention sweeper is paused and its last deletion batch is fully committed before unsealing its signing key. Verify both custodians have acknowledged the ceremony window in the ops log. Once verified, unseal using the recovery passphrase recorded immediately below this line.

vault phrase of tawig-taduf = zorath-oliwyn

14:22 — Mira from the Lanternfish SDK team confirmed that the Kestrel (mobile) client shipped retry batching in 4.2 while the Osprey (web) client had not, explaining the divergent error rates. We froze web releases pending parity and flagged the gap in the Driftline parity matrix. The web build that restored parity is identified by the token below.

build token for fajof-yahof: htk4_869f